Understanding Temperature Scales
First, don't forget to clarify which temperature scale is being used. In the United States, temperatures are usually given in Fahrenheit, while most other countries use Celsius. This distinction is crucial because 51 degrees means very different things depending on the scale.

51 Degrees Fahrenheit
If the temperature is 51 degrees Fahrenheit, it is generally considered cool, especially if you're used to warmer weather. This temperature is just above the freezing point of water (32°F) and is often associated with the chill of early spring or late autumn. 51 Degrees Celsius
On the flip side, if the temperature is 51 degrees Celsius, that's a completely different story. On the flip side, this is extremely hot—far beyond what most people would consider comfortable. To put it in perspective, 51°C is about 124°F, which is hotter than the average human body temperature and can pose serious health risks, including heatstroke and dehydration Small thing, real impact..
In Celsius, 51 degrees is definitely hot, and it's a temperature that requires caution, especially if you're outdoors or in a place without air conditioning. This kind of heat is more common in desert regions or during extreme heat waves.

Tips for Dealing with 51 Degrees
Whether you're facing 51 degrees Fahrenheit or Celsius, don't forget to be prepared.
For 51°F (Cool Weather)
- Dress in layers so you can adjust to changing temperatures.
- Wear a light jacket or sweater if you'll be outside for a while.
- Keep an umbrella or rain jacket handy, as cool temperatures often bring rain.
For 51°C (Extreme Heat)
- Stay indoors during the hottest parts of the day.
- Drink plenty of water to avoid dehydration.
- Wear light, loose-fitting clothing and a hat if you must go outside.
- Avoid strenuous activity and seek air-conditioned environments whenever possible.

Environmental and Societal Implications
The shifting thermal landscape also carries broader ecological consequences. So urban heat islands—areas where concrete and asphalt absorb and re‑emit heat—exacerbate temperature extremes, placing additional stress on power grids during peak demand. That said, addressing this requires greening initiatives such as planting shade‑providing trees, installing reflective surfaces, and creating communal cooling centers that double as public spaces. Beyond that, public health campaigns that educate citizens about the signs of heat‑related illness and the importance of hydration can dramatically lower emergency room admissions during heat waves. On a societal level, equitable access to cooling resources remains a critical issue; ensuring that low‑income neighborhoods receive the same level of protection as affluent ones is essential for social justice and collective well‑being.
